Green style - Instructions for this can be found in the /documentation/readme of your download package, but it is very easy just by going to Style Properties -> Color Palette, and change the Global Hue slider for all color properties. This will change them all from blue to green or any color you want. There are many other instructions in the readme file for all Nulumia features.

@Nirjonadda I would definitely change all the Nulumia properties as groups (also @primaries and @secondaries), not choose individually. If you're using additional properties (such as added colors at bottom), you can use the slider next to each group separately, instead of the Global slider. But I would not leave some Nulumia Properties untouched as you will end up with mismatched colors -- they are all used somewhere within the theme, even if they seem unimportant.

The two most important in DarkTabbed are @primaryMedium and @primaryLight. They are used for most colors in the theme.
